The Cuban Sandwich
Hood Burger
Special Edition
Specs
  • hoagie bread roll
  • pulled pork marinated in orange, lime, garlic, oregano, cumin, pepper, and paprika
  • mustard
  • sauce (with lemon, orange, mint)
  • Cheddar cheese
  • cooked prosciutto
  • pickles
Review
Acidity overdose.

In retrospect, I was unduly harsh in my original review. Or maybe my tastes changed, I don't know. The point is, score go up.

At the end of the day, however, this is still a wildly unbalanced sandwich. I understand that you can't let the richness of pulled pork and Cheddar simply run wild. But at what point does the cure get worse than the condition it's treating? Just look at that spec sheet: pickles and mustard and citrus-based sauce and citrus-based marinade? It's just too damn much!

Personally, I'd ditch the pickles and add a different vegetable. Arugula, perhaps. Or simply something more neutral/less overtly acidic. The score would shoot up. But as it stands, middle of the road score is as high as I can go.
